Dart Shaft Material: A Deeper Dive
The material of your dart shaft significantly impacts its flexibility, durability, and weight. A well-chosen shaft enhances the overall feel and control of your throw. There are several popular choices, each with its advantages and disadvantages. Let’s look at some of the most common:
- Nylon: Nylon shafts are a popular choice for beginners because they are relatively inexpensive and durable. They offer good stiffness and are resistant to bending. However, they may not be as aesthetically pleasing or provide the same level of feel as other materials.
- Aluminum: Aluminum shafts provide superior durability and weight compared to nylon. They are also very stiff, making them a good option for players who prefer a consistent and predictable flight. The downside is the price; aluminum shafts are often more expensive than nylon.
- Carbon Fiber: Carbon fiber shafts are known for their extreme lightweight and high strength. They are also very stiff and durable, resisting bending under pressure. These shafts tend to be more expensive, but many players find the enhanced performance worth the cost. They offer an excellent balance of weight, durability, and stiffness.
When choosing a dart shaft material, consider factors such as your throwing style, budget, and the level of performance you desire. For example, a beginner might find nylon shafts sufficient, while more advanced players might appreciate the benefits of aluminum or carbon fiber. The Interplay of Dart Shaft Material and Barrel Grip
The dart shaft material and barrel grip aren’t independent entities; they work together to influence your throw. A stiff shaft paired with a parallel grip can provide excellent stability, while a more flexible shaft with a finger grip might allow for more finesse. The interplay between these two elements is crucial for maximizing your performance.
For instance, a player who prefers a very controlled throw might opt for a stiff aluminum or carbon fiber shaft in combination with a parallel grip. This setup minimizes shaft flex and provides maximum stability throughout the throw. Conversely, a player prioritizing a softer throw and more freedom of movement might prefer a nylon shaft with a more relaxed finger grip. This combination might allow for a more natural release and less restrictive control.

Advanced Considerations: Weight and Balance
Beyond the material and grip, the overall weight and balance of your darts contribute significantly to the throwing experience. The combined weight of the barrel, shaft, and flights all affect the flight path and stability of the dart. A heavier dart will usually have a more powerful trajectory, but that could compromise accuracy for some players. Therefore, experimenting with different weights is crucial to find the right fit.
The balance point of your dart – the point at which it balances evenly – is another critical factor. This balance point will vary depending on the weight and material distribution of the dart. An appropriately balanced dart allows for a smoother throw, reduces hand strain, and improves consistency. Many players choose darts that are slightly front-heavy for a more controlled flight.
When considering weight and balance, think of how they interact with your chosen dart shaft material and barrel grip. A heavy barrel with a stiff shaft might require a more powerful throw, while a lighter barrel with a flexible shaft could allow for more delicate control.
